June Weekend with Jacquie Gering

July 12, 2017

In June, we were very fortunate to host the very talented and amazing Jacquie Gering for a workshop and lecture/trunk show. 

For Jacquie, it was a little like coming home; she once lived in Chicago and is a former member of our guild. 

The weekend started with an all-day workshop on Saturday, June 24. The class she taught was “Creative Quilting with the Walking Foot.” Jacquie first discussed the importance of constructing a proper “quilt sandwich” and how doing so can reduce puckers in your quilt. She then had us do some exercises to get acquainted with our various walking feet, as they vary by manufacturer. 

Then, we were ready for some quilting! Jacquie is such an amazing instructor; she took us all beyond straight line quilting and had us all doing curves and spirals all with our walking foot. She discussed how you can use the decorative stitches on your machine for quilting, and she even had design ideas for those who had straight stitch-only sewing machines.  

To learn more about Jacquie’s approach take a look at her new book WALK: Master Machine Quilting with Your Walking Foot.

On Sunday, June 25, Jacquie returned to the guild for a lecture: “Modern Quilting: You’ll Know It When You See It.” In this lecture, she discussed what modern quilting means to her. She showed us her quilts…she had a lot of them to share! With each quilt, she told us the story behind it. It was great seeing her work in person after admiring her work online.
